Recall - Aluminum Wheel Replacement

NUMBER: WWI-92
DATE: 09/2002
APPLICABILITY: Certain 2003MY Outback and Legacy Vehicles

SUBJECT: Aluminum Road Wheels

INTRODUCTION

Subaru of America, Inc. (SOA) has determined that affected vehicles may have been produced with improperly manufactured aluminum wheels. The 5-hub-bolt-circle diameter may be off-center in relation to the center of the hub hole. The off-center condition can result in the eventual loosening of wheel lug nuts during vehicle usage.

This recall will involve the replacement of the aluminum wheels on affected vehicles.

AFFECTED VEHICLES

Certain 2003MY Legacy and Outback Models with H6 six-cylinder engine.

OWNER NOTIFICATION

Notification letters will be sent to owners of affected vehicles on or around September 12,2002.

DEALER PROGRAM RESPONSIBILITY

Dealers are to promptly service all vehicles subject to this recall at no charge to the vehicle owner regardless of mileage, age of the vehicle, or ownership.

For affected vehicles sold after the date on the dealer's computer list, dealers are to contact those owners and provide them with a copy of the owner notification letter. They should also arrange to make the required correction according to the instructions in the service procedure section of this bulletin.

VEHICLES IN DEALER INVENTORY

Dealers are also to promptly perform the applicable service procedures defined in this bulletin to correct all affected vehicles in their inventory (new, used, demo). Additionally, whenever a vehicle subject to this recall is taken into dealer new or used inventory, or is in the dealership for service, necessary steps should be taken to ensure the recall correction has been made before selling or releasing the vehicle.

New or used vehicles listed in a recall/campaign that are in dealer stock must be:

^ Immediately identified.
^ Tagged or otherwise marked to prevent their delivery or use prior to inspection and/or repair.
^ Inspected and/or repaired in accordance with instructions outlined in the Product Campaign Bulletin.

Any Authorized Subaru Dealer failing to perform the applicable service procedures defined in this bulletin to correct all affected vehicles in their inventory (new, used, demo) prior to the vehicle being placed in service may be subject to civil penalties of up to $5,000 per violation (i.e., for each vehicle), as provided in 49 USC 30165(a) of the Safety Act, and will also be in breach of the Subaru Dealer Agreement.

PARTS INFORMATION

Each dealer will automatically be sent a quantity of replacement aluminum wheels with tires pre-mounted and balanced. They will be shipped in sets of four equal to the number of affected vehicles allocated to the dealer of record.

REPAIR PROCEDURES

Replace the set of aluminum wheels with tires following the procedures published in the applicable Subaru Service Manual. The replacement tire & wheel assemblies are shipped balanced and matched as a set. If the dealer has more than one vehicle affected, do not mix the wheels from 2 different sets.





RECALL CAMPAIGN IDENTIFICATION LABEL

Type or print the necessary information on a Recall Campaign identification label. The completed label should be attached to the vehicle's upper radiator support.
